Discover the Black history of Bankside in this walk that covers over 400 years and includes: Shakespeare, black sailors, international trade, pirates, food , religion, Pan Africanism, Marcus Garvey, Roman ruins and Windrush.

The tour is led by Black History Walks, who run guided Walking Tours of London to include its African history which goes back 3,500 years.
